Company History and Background
Meijer was founded in 1934 by Hendrik Meijer and his son Fred Meijer. The first Meijer store, located in Greenville, Michigan, initially started as a small grocery store. Over the years, Meijer expanded its operations and diversified its product range to include groceries, household items, clothing, electronics, and more.
Today, Meijer operates over 240 stores across multiple states, serving millions of customers. The company’s success can be attributed to its dedication to providing quality products at competitive prices while prioritizing customer satisfaction. The combination of a wide range of products, affordable prices, and a focus on customer needs has helped Meijer build a loyal customer base.

Strong Market Presence
One of Meijer’s key strengths is its strong market presence. With over 240 stores across Michigan, Illinois, Indiana, Ohio, Kentucky, and Wisconsin, Meijer has established a significant footprint in these regions (Meijer Careers). The company’s expansion plans, including the opening of stores in Detroit and Wisconsin in 2023, further solidify its market presence.

Limited Geographic Reach
One of the weaknesses of Meijer is its limited geographic reach. Currently, Meijer primarily operates in the Midwest region of the United States, with stores located in Michigan, Illinois, Indiana, Ohio, Kentucky, and Wisconsin (Meijer Careers). This limited presence may hinder its ability to tap into potential markets and expand its customer base beyond the Midwest. Comprehensive Benefits Package
Meijer offers a comprehensive benefits package to its employees, ensuring their health and financial security. This package includes medical, dental, and vision insurance coverage for both part-time and full-time team members, as well as their dependents (Glassdoor). The company also provides a 401(k) matching program, allowing employees to save for retirement with Meijer contributing 4% of an employee’s contribution after a vesting period of 3 years.
Furthermore, Meijer employees can enjoy discounts at Meijer stores and receive discounts on other products and services through the company’s partnerships. These benefits contribute to the overall well-being and satisfaction of Meijer’s team members.

Philanthropic Initiatives
Meijer strives to make a positive impact in the communities it serves through philanthropic efforts. The company supports programs that address hunger relief, education, and diversity. One notable initiative is the Meijer Simply Give program, which provides food to local food pantries. This program allows customers to purchase $10 Simply Give donation cards at Meijer stores, with every purchase matched by Meijer. To date, the program has generated millions of dollars to support local food banks and pantries, ensuring that individuals and families have access to nutritious food.
